TIMBER PRODUCTION

The Mivoisin Estate owns around 3,500 acres of woodlands, and the management aims here are to achieve long term timber production as well as providing a wonderful environment for wildlife.

The Management Plan promotes mixed aged woodlands in order to encourage maximum diversity and a greater abundance of tree species.

The woodland policy on the Estate ensures a sustainable future and seeks to provide better protection against adverse weather conditions, and at the same time encourages more unusual varieties such as Acacia, Wild Service, Wild Cherry and Alder.

Our forest products are sold mainly to sawmills or for barrel making and more recently for fuel for renewable energy to district heating companies.
